Genetic Influences

One of the most extensively studied areas of high IQ is its heritability. Researchers estimate that approximately 50% of intelligence is inherited from our biological parents. This means that genes play a crucial role in shaping our cognitive abilities, but the degree of impact is still subject to debate. Studies have found that certain genes are associated with higher IQ scores, such as those related to memory, attention, and problem-solving. However, environmental factors can also affect how genes are expressed.

Environmental Factors

Environmental factors can also substantially influence IQ scores. They include access to education and cultural opportunities, exposure to toxins and malnutrition, and social and emotional support. For example, children who grow up in poverty or harsh family environments are more likely to experience stress, which can impair their cognitive development. On the other hand, children who have nurturing and stimulating environments tend to perform better on intelligence tests. Additionally, educational interventions, such as early childhood education programs, have been shown to enhance cognitive abilities.

Neurological Factors

IQ is ultimately a biological phenomenon, and its neural basis has been a subject of extensive research. Studies have shown that highly intelligent individuals tend to have faster neural processing speed, greater working memory capacity, and better attentional control than their less intelligent counterparts. Furthermore, brain structure and function can be affected by various factors, such as stress, disease, and aging, which can influence cognitive performance.

Genetics: Is Intelligence Inherited?

Many researchers believe that intelligence is influenced by both genetic and environmental factors. While there is no single gene responsible for high intelligence, studies suggest that genetic factors play a role in IQ.

Understanding the Heritability of Intelligence

Heritability refers to the degree to which differences in traits, such as IQ, can be accounted for by genetic variations. Research suggests that heritability plays a role in determining IQ. In fact, twin studies have shown that identical twins, who share 100% of their genes, tend to have more similar IQs than fraternal twins, who share only 50% of their genes. However, the exact percentage of IQ influenced by genetics is still debated among researchers.

The Influence of Environment

While genetics may play a role in determining intelligence, environmental factors can also have a significant impact. Factors such as education, nutrition, and socio-economic status have all been shown to influence IQ. Research has also demonstrated that environmental factors can actually modify gene expression, meaning that while genetics may lay the foundation for IQ, the environment can still shape and influence it.

Overall, the relationship between genetics and intelligence is complex and multifaceted. While genetics likely play a role in determining IQ, environmental factors can also have a significant impact. Further research is needed to fully understand the interplay between genetics and environment in shaping intelligence.

Nutrition and Brain Development: Can Diet Affect IQ?

Proper nutrition is essential for overall health, but did you know it can also impact the development of the brain and potentially even affect a person’s IQ? Recent research has explored the relationship between diet and cognitive function. While the full extent of the connection is not yet clear, evidence suggests that certain nutrients play a role in brain development and cognitive processes.

Studies have shown that a diet rich in omega-3 fatty acids, such as those found in fish and nuts, may contribute to better cognitive function. On the other hand, diets high in saturated fats and sugar have been linked to poorer cognitive scores in both children and adults.

Furthermore, some researchers believe that certain vitamins and minerals, like iron and iodine, are crucial for brain development and may impact IQ. A lack of these nutrients during critical periods of development could potentially hinder cognitive function and lead to long-term consequences.

While more research is needed to fully understand the relationship between nutrition and IQ, it is clear that diet plays a significant role in brain development and cognitive function. Ensuring a balanced and nutritious diet could potentially lead to improved cognitive abilities and better overall health.

The Big Five Personality Traits

One commonly used model of personality traits is the Big Five personality traits, which categorizes personality into five dimensions: openness to experience, conscientiousness, extraversion, agreeableness, and neuroticism. Some studies suggest that individuals who score high in openness to experience tend to be more creative and have higher intellectual abilities. Meanwhile, those who score high in conscientiousness have been found to have better self-regulation and discipline, which may contribute to their academic achievements.

FAQ

What is IQ, and why is it important?

IQ stands for intelligence quotient, which is a measure of a person’s cognitive abilities and intellectual potential. A high IQ score is often associated with success in many areas of life, such as education, career, and problem-solving abilities.

What are some of the factors that contribute to high IQ?

There are many factors that contribute to high IQ, including genetics, parental education and income, environmental factors like education and nutrition, and early childhood experiences. However, researchers are still trying to understand the complex interplay of these factors.

Are IQ scores fixed for life, or can they be improved?

While IQ scores are generally considered stable across a person’s lifespan, they are not fixed and can be improved with education, practice, and other interventions. However, the extent to which IQ scores can be improved is still a matter of some debate among psychologists.

Can anyone become a genius or have a high IQ, or is it determined by genetics?

IQ is largely influenced by genetics, but many environmental factors also play a role. While not everyone can become a genius or have a high IQ, it is possible for individuals to reach their full cognitive potential through education, training, and other interventions.

What are some common misconceptions about IQ and intelligence?

One common misconception is that IQ is the only measure of intelligence, when in fact there are many different types of intelligence that are not captured by IQ tests. Additionally, IQ scores do not measure other important traits such as creativity, social skills, emotional intelligence, or practical knowledge and experience.
